Not only are most of the better restaurants open ...August in Paris, France, brings an average high-temperature of a still moderately hot 24.5°C (76.1°F), nearly identical to the preceding month. Throughout August, the average low-temperature in Paris dips to a mild 15°C (59°F). Humidity August is the least humid month, with an average relative humidity of 68%. The hottest day ever recorded in August in Paris is 40.3°C, and the lowest temperature ever measured in the city this month is 5.9°C. Rain/Snow in Paris in August. During August, Paris receives an average of 55 mm of precipitation over 7 days. For the ideal Paris packing list, you need to know what the weather is like during the summer months. Paris is not nearly as deserted in August as some travel guides claim; they tend to be many years behind the times.. In the old days, Paris did become very quiet in August, and a lot of places did close. This is far less common today. Jun 9, 2023 · In summer, Parisians favor lightweight, comfortable, and chic clothing in neutral colors. Classic items like straight-leg jeans, white tees, summer dresses, and tailored shorts are popular. The key is a minimalist, effortless look, often accented with accessories like a straw hat or a silk scarf.
